Laboratory Technician
United Pharma Technologies Inc is seeking a GMP Sample Management / Laboratory Operations Technician to support daily laboratory operations in a regulated pharmaceutical/biotech environment. This role involves managing GMP samples and ensuring compliance with relevant procedures.
Responsibilities
Receive, log, track, store, and process GMP samples
Use LabVantage and MODA systems for sample tracking and documentation
Perform glassware washing, equipment cleaning, and general lab upkeep
Support laboratory operations across multiple shifts as needed
Ensure compliance with GMPs, SOPs, and site procedures
Partner with lab and operations teams to maintain efficient sample flow and lab readiness
Qualification
Required
2–7 years of experience in a GMP laboratory environment
Hands-on experience with GMP sample management
Working knowledge of LabVantage and MODA (required)
Familiarity with GMP documentation and SOP-driven environments
Comfortable in a technician-level role (not a scientist/analyst position)
Preferred
Associate's or Bachelor's degree in Life Sciences or related field
Experience supporting QC or Analytical laboratories
